About

The three-and-a-half-year programme emphasises on the key fundamentals of financial research and development framework, as well as on developing multimedia and ICT literacy to compete in today financial industry. The Programme will provide students with thorough understanding in financial supremacy and technological financial strategy in business. Students will be familiarised with financial subjects such as Mathematics for Finance, Principles of Finance, Differential Equations, and others.

The fundamentals of financial literacy is then supplemented with technologically related subjects, in a move to produce graduates with great financial efficiency and competitiveness. In doing so, students will be engaged in subjects such as Computer Networks and Internet Computing, Database Management Systems, Computer Programming, Database Management Systems, Computer Networks and Internet Computing, Mathematical Programming and Software Engineering.

Career Prospects:
Researchers, analysts, executives and managers in commercial banking, insurance, unit trusts, investment banking, risk management, forex, financial derivatives, capital and equity market.

Entry Requirements

  1. Pass Foundation/Matriculation studies from a recognised institution with a minimum CGPA of 2.50 and a Credit in Mathematics and a Pass in English at SPM Level or its equivalent; OR
  2. Pass STPM or its equivalent with a minimum Grade C+ (GP 2.33) in 2 subjects AND a Credit in Mathematics and a Pass in English at SPM Level or its equivalent; OR
  3. Pass A-Level with a minimum of Grade D in 2 subjects AND a Credit in Mathematics and a Pass in English at SPM Level or its equivalent; OR
  4. Pass UEC with a minimum of Grade B in at least five (5) subjects inclusive of Mathematics and English; OR
  5. Pass STAM with a minimum Grade Jayyid (Good) in 2 subjects AND a Credit in Mathematics and a Pass in English at SPM Level or its equivalent; OR
  6. Any qualification equivalent to Diploma in Finance, Banking, Insurance or related field (Level 4, MQF) with a minimum CGPA of 2.50 out of 4.00.

Note
The Credit requirement for Mathematics and Pass in English at SPM Level for candidate in the above category (excluding UEC) can be waived should the qualifications contain Mathematics and English subjects with equivalent higher achievement
